summaryrefslogtreecommitdiff
path: root/deskutils
diff options
context:
space:
mode:
authorMichael Johnson <ahze@FreeBSD.org>2005-09-01 03:46:18 +0000
committerMichael Johnson <ahze@FreeBSD.org>2005-09-01 03:46:18 +0000
commit6b3e979f133d308cf0746d3bbd600c52af9ec8ac (patch)
treee879086072dc2cfe049970d69bc9c1cb71c28850 /deskutils
parent- Update to 0.28 (diff)
- Add nautilus-actions
An extension for Nautilus, the gnome file manager, which allow to configure program to be launch on files selected into Nautilus interface.
Notes
Notes: svn path=/head/; revision=141665
Diffstat (limited to 'deskutils')
-rw-r--r--deskutils/Makefile1
-rw-r--r--deskutils/nautilus-actions/Makefile22
-rw-r--r--deskutils/nautilus-actions/distinfo2
-rw-r--r--deskutils/nautilus-actions/files/patch-Makefile24
-rw-r--r--deskutils/nautilus-actions/pkg-descr4
-rw-r--r--deskutils/nautilus-actions/pkg-plist9
6 files changed, 62 insertions, 0 deletions
diff --git a/deskutils/Makefile b/deskutils/Makefile
index b16f14834b37..b72564e1287e 100644
--- a/deskutils/Makefile
+++ b/deskutils/Makefile
@@ -107,6 +107,7 @@
SUBDIR += multisync-syncml
SUBDIR += nag
SUBDIR += narval
+ SUBDIR += nautilus-actions
SUBDIR += nautilus-sendto
SUBDIR += notebook
SUBDIR += notification-daemon
diff --git a/deskutils/nautilus-actions/Makefile b/deskutils/nautilus-actions/Makefile
new file mode 100644
index 000000000000..8671ea0183f2
--- /dev/null
+++ b/deskutils/nautilus-actions/Makefile
@@ -0,0 +1,22 @@
+# New ports collection makefile for: nautilus-actions
+# Date created: 2005-08-31
+# Whom: Michael Johnson <ahze@FreeBSD.org>
+#
+# $FreeBSD$
+#
+
+PORTNAME= nautilus-actions
+PORTVERSION= 0.5
+CATEGORIES= deskutils
+MASTER_SITES= ${MASTER_SITE_LOCAL} \
+ http://people.freebsd.org/~ahze/distfiles/
+MASTER_SITE_SUBDIR= ahze
+
+MAINTAINER= ahze@FreeBSD.org
+COMMENT= Extension for Nautilus to configure programs to launch on files
+
+USE_GNOME= nautilus2 pygtk2
+USE_PYTHON= yes
+USE_X_PREFIX= yes
+
+.include <bsd.port.mk>
diff --git a/deskutils/nautilus-actions/distinfo b/deskutils/nautilus-actions/distinfo
new file mode 100644
index 000000000000..892a8d8c7616
--- /dev/null
+++ b/deskutils/nautilus-actions/distinfo
@@ -0,0 +1,2 @@
+MD5 (nautilus-actions-0.5.tar.gz) = c3606d293eb4cf0d49dcaa603169ddfd
+SIZE (nautilus-actions-0.5.tar.gz) = 49272
diff --git a/deskutils/nautilus-actions/files/patch-Makefile b/deskutils/nautilus-actions/files/patch-Makefile
new file mode 100644
index 000000000000..2498b90f55d2
--- /dev/null
+++ b/deskutils/nautilus-actions/files/patch-Makefile
@@ -0,0 +1,24 @@
+--- Makefile.orig Wed Aug 31 02:54:22 2005
++++ Makefile Wed Aug 31 22:25:42 2005
+@@ -1,9 +1,9 @@
+-prefix=/usr
++prefix=$(PREFIX)
+ libdir=$(prefix)/lib
+ bindir=${prefix}/bin
+ DESTDIR=
+-GNOME_MENU_DIR=$(prefix)/share/applications
+-DEFAULT_CONFIG_PATH=$(prefix)/share/nautilus-actions
++GNOME_MENU_DIR=$(prefix)/share/gnome/applications
++DEFAULT_CONFIG_PATH=$(prefix)/share/gnome/nautilus-actions
+ DEFAULT_PER_USER_PATH=.config/.nautilus-actions
+ OLD_DEFAULT_PER_USER_PATH=.nautilus-actions
+ DEFAULT_NACT_DATA_PATH=$(DEFAULT_CONFIG_PATH)/nact
+@@ -16,7 +16,7 @@
+ all: $(EXT_NAME) nact/nautilus-actions-config.py nact/nact nact/nautilus-actions-config.glade nact/nact.desktop
+
+ $(EXT_NAME): $(SOURCES) $(HEADERS)
+- gcc -o $(EXT_NAME) -shared -fPIC -DDEFAULT_CONFIG_PATH="\"$(DEFAULT_CONFIG_PATH)\"" -DDEFAULT_PER_USER_PATH="\"$(DEFAULT_PER_USER_PATH)\"" -I. `pkg-config --libs --cflags libnautilus-extension libxml-2.0 gobject-2.0` $(SOURCES)
++ $(CC) -o $(EXT_NAME) -shared -fPIC $(CFLAGS) -DDEFAULT_CONFIG_PATH="\"$(DEFAULT_CONFIG_PATH)\"" -DDEFAULT_PER_USER_PATH="\"$(DEFAULT_PER_USER_PATH)\"" -I. `pkg-config --libs --cflags libnautilus-extension libxml-2.0 gobject-2.0` $(SOURCES)
+
+ nact/nautilus-actions-config.py: nact/nautilus-actions-config.py.template
+ sed -e 's#%%%DEFAULT_CONFIG_PATH%%%#$(DEFAULT_CONFIG_PATH)#' -e 's#%%%DATA_DIR%%%#$(DEFAULT_NACT_DATA_PATH)#' -e 's#%%%VERSION%%%#$(VERSION)#' -e 's#%%%DEFAULT_PER_USER_PATH%%%#$(DEFAULT_PER_USER_PATH)#' -e 's#%%%OLD_DEFAULT_PER_USER_PATH%%%#$(OLD_DEFAULT_PER_USER_PATH)#' nact/nautilus-actions-config.py.template > nact/nautilus-actions-config.py
diff --git a/deskutils/nautilus-actions/pkg-descr b/deskutils/nautilus-actions/pkg-descr
new file mode 100644
index 000000000000..38c86c282a8d
--- /dev/null
+++ b/deskutils/nautilus-actions/pkg-descr
@@ -0,0 +1,4 @@
+An extension for Nautilus, the gnome file manager, which allow to configure
+program to be launch on files selected into Nautilus interface.
+
+WWW: http://www.grumz.net/index.php?q=node/8
diff --git a/deskutils/nautilus-actions/pkg-plist b/deskutils/nautilus-actions/pkg-plist
new file mode 100644
index 000000000000..6291b1def98b
--- /dev/null
+++ b/deskutils/nautilus-actions/pkg-plist
@@ -0,0 +1,9 @@
+bin/nact
+lib/nautilus/extensions-1.0/nautilus-action.so
+share/gnome/applications/nact.desktop
+share/gnome/nautilus-actions/config_newaction.xml
+share/gnome/nautilus-actions/nact/nautilus-actions-config.glade
+share/gnome/nautilus-actions/nact/nautilus-actions-config.py
+share/gnome/nautilus-actions/nact/nautilus-launch-icon.png
+@dirrm share/gnome/nautilus-actions/nact
+@dirrm share/gnome/nautilus-actions